my setup with the crower 3s

11.5:1
89mm bore
.5mm oversized valves (low comp)
decked head .004
eagle h beam rods
sk2 valve train
crower retainers
port and polish
gutted stock IM
short ram intake
DSM 450cc
2.5in cat back



the bad
shitty ebay header
short ram intake
stock tb
VAFC2 tune



210whp at 7700 with power curve still goin up on dynojet
ran a 14.1 on street tires
i feel like it will make good power till 9000 but that is only a guess

future plans
Good header, bisi smsp or rmf
ITBs
hondata

compression test doesnt necissarily tell you what your compression is, it just lets you know your cylinder is holding compression. Your cam lobe and overlap has alot to do with your actual compression
